Gentiles and the New Covenant"},"content":{"rendered":"\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">How the Nations Became Children of Abraham Through Christ<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">One of the great themes running throughout Scripture is God&#8217;s plan not merely to save one nation, but ultimately to gather <strong>all nations into one covenant family<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The story begins with Abraham.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">God called Abraham and made extraordinary promises to him, including the promise that: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cIn you all the families of the earth shall be blessed.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Genesis 12:3<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Israel was chosen for a purpose.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Through Israel would come the Messiah, and through the Messiah the blessing promised to Abraham would eventually reach the entire world.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The New Testament reveals how this happens.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">It happens <strong>through Jesus Christ<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">What Does \u201cGentile\u201d Mean?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">In the Bible, a Gentile is simply someone who is <strong>not ethnically Jewish<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Jewish people descended from Abraham, Isaac and Jacob, while the other nations were generally referred to as the Gentiles.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">For centuries there was a visible distinction between Israel and the nations.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Israel possessed: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>the covenants<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>the Law<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>the Temple<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>the priesthood<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>the promises<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>the prophets<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">St Paul describes these extraordinary privileges in Romans 9.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">But those privileges were never meant to terminate in Israel alone.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">They were preparing the world for Christ.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Abraham Was Promised a Worldwide Family<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Long before Moses received the Law at Mount Sinai, God had already promised Abraham that he would become the father of <strong>many nations<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cI have made you the father of many nations.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Romans 4:17<br>See Genesis 17:5<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ul explains something remarkable.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Abraham&#8217;s true family would ultimately not be defined merely by physical descent.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Abraham believed God <strong>before he was circumcised<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ul therefore argues that Abraham can be the spiritual father both of believing Jews and believing Gentiles.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cHe is the father of all who believe without being circumcised.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Romans 4:11<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">This means God&#8217;s plan for the Gentiles did not suddenly appear in the New Testament.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">It was already present in the promise made to Abraham.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Christ Is the Promised Seed of Abraham<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ul takes the argument even further in Galatians.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He writes: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cThe promises were made to Abraham and to his offspring\u2026 who is Christ.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Galatians 3:16<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The promises given to Abraham reach their fulfilment in <strong>Jesus Christ<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Christ is the promised descendant of Abraham through whom the nations are blessed.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Therefore the crucial question becomes: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>How does someone become part of Abraham&#8217;s family?<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ul gives the answer only a few verses later.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Baptized Into Christ<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Galatians 3:26-29 is one of the clearest passages in the entire New Testament.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ul writes: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cFor in Christ Jesus you are all sons of God, through faith.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He then immediately connects this with baptism: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cFor as many of you as were baptized into Christ have put on Christ.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">And then comes the extraordinary conclusion: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cThere is neither Jew nor Greek\u2026 for you are all one in Christ Jesus.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Finally: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cAnd if you are Christ&#8217;s, then you are Abraham&#8217;s offspring, heirs according to promise.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u2014 Galatians 3:26-29<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">This is enormously important.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">A Gentile does not need to become ethnically Jewish in order to inherit the promise of Abraham.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He becomes united to <strong>Christ<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">And because Christ is the promised Seed of Abraham, everyone united to Christ becomes an heir of the promise.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The logic is simple: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Abraham \u2192 Christ \u2192 those united to Christ<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Therefore Paul can tell Gentile Christians: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>You are Abraham&#8217;s offspring.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">\u201cNeither Jew Nor Greek\u201d<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">When Paul says: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cThere is neither Jew nor Greek.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">he is not claiming that ethnic differences suddenly disappear.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">A Jewish Christian remains ethnically Jewish.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">A Greek Christian remains Greek.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">A man remains a man and a woman remains a woman.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ul&#8217;s point is that these distinctions do not determine someone&#8217;s standing before God.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The doorway into God&#8217;s covenant family is now the same for everyone: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Jesus Christ.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Jew and Gentile alike must come through Him.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Jesus Had Already Foretold This<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Jesus Himself predicted that people from the Gentile nations would enter the Kingdom.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">After encountering the extraordinary faith of a Roman centurion, Jesus said: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cMany will come from east and west and recline at table with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ob in the kingdom of heaven.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Matthew 8:11<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Think about what Jesus is saying.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">People who were not physical descendants of Abraham would nevertheless sit at the covenant banquet with: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Abraham<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Isaac<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Jacob<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Gentiles were coming into the family.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Kingdom would spread beyond the geographical boundaries of Israel.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">The Great Commission<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">After His Resurrection, Jesus makes this worldwide mission explicit.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He commands the Apostles: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cGo therefore and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them\u2026\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Matthew 28:19<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Greek word translated <strong>nations<\/strong> is <em>ethn\u0113<\/em>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">It is the same basic word frequently associated with the <strong>Gentiles<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The covenant mission has now exploded outward.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">No longer is God&#8217;s worship centred upon one earthly nation.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Apostles are sent throughout the world.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Every nation is invited.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Cornelius: The Door Opens to the Gentiles<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Acts 10 gives us one of the decisive moments in the early Church.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Cornelius was a Roman centurion.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He was a Gentile.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">God sends St Peter to his household.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">As Peter preaches Christ, the Holy Spirit falls upon the Gentiles.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Peter is astonished.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He declares: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cCan anyone withhold water for baptizing these people, who have received the Holy Spirit just as we have?\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Acts 10:47<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Cornelius and his household are baptized.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">This was revolutionary.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Gentiles were entering the Church <strong>without first becoming Jews<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">The Council of Jerusalem<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The issue soon became so important that the Apostles gathered to settle it.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Some Christians were claiming that Gentile converts needed to be circumcised and keep the Mosaic Law.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Acts 15 records the dispute.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">St Peter reminds the assembly that God had already given the Holy Spirit to the Gentiles.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He then declares: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cWe believe that we will be saved through the grace of the Lord Jesus, just as they will.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Acts 15:11<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Notice the direction of Peter&#8217;s statement.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He does not say: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>The Gentiles will become Jews and then be saved.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Instead: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Both Jew and Gentile are saved by <strong>the grace of Jesus Christ<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Apostles therefore reject the demand that Gentile converts must first become Jews.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">The Dividing Wall Is Broken Down<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">St Paul gives one of the most beautiful descriptions of this mystery in Ephesians 2.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Speaking directly to Gentile Christians, he reminds them that they were once: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cstrangers to the covenants of promise.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">They were: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cwithout hope and without God in the world.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">But then everything changes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cBut now in Christ Jesus you who once were far off have been brought near by the blood of Christ.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Ephesians 2:13<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Christ has brought Jew and Gentile together.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ul says Christ: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201chas made us both one.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The hostility separating Jew and Gentile has been broken down.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">And Christ creates: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cone new man\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">from the two.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u2014 Ephesians 2:14-15<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">This is the Church.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Not two competing peoples of God.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">One covenant people gathered around one Messiah.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">No Longer Strangers<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ul concludes: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cSo then you are no longer strangers and aliens, but you are fellow citizens with the saints and members of the household of God.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Ephesians 2:19<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">That is the position of the Gentile Christian.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Once outside the covenant.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Now: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>a citizen<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>an heir<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>a member of God&#8217;s household<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>a child of Abraham through Christ<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">What Is a True Jew?<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ul makes another striking statement in Romans 2.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">He writes: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cA person is not a Jew who is one merely outwardly\u2026 but a Jew is one inwardly, and circumcision is a matter of the heart, by the Spirit.\u201d<\/strong><br>\u2014 Romans 2:28-29<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ul is drawing upon something already taught in the Old Testament.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">God had repeatedly demanded not merely physical circumcision but <strong>circumcision of the heart<\/strong>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">See: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Deuteronomy 10:16<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Deuteronomy 30:6<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Jeremiah 4:4<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">External membership alone was never enough.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">God desired an interior conversion.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">In the New Covenant this reaches its fulfilment through the Holy Spirit.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">The Heavenly has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">The Gentiles Are Grafted In<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">However, there is an extremely important warning that must accompany everything above.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ul does <strong>not<\/strong> permit Gentile Christians to become arrogant toward the Jewish people.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Romans 11 uses the image of an olive tree.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Some natural branches were broken off because of unbelief.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Gentile believers were then: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cgrafted in.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u2014 Romans 11:17<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">But Paul immediately warns the Gentiles: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cDo not be arrogant toward the branches.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">And: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cDo not become proud, but fear.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u2014 Romans 11:18,20<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Why?<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Because the Gentile Christian does not support the root.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>The root supports him.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Christianity does not begin by despising Israel.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Christianity exists because God&#8217;s promises to Israel reached their fulfilment in Israel&#8217;s Messiah: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Jesus Christ.<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Jesus is Jewish.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Mary is Jewish.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Apostles are Jewish.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The first Christians are Jewish.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Scriptures of the Old Covenant were entrusted to Israel.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Gentiles have been brought into a story God began long before them.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">God Has Not Forgotten the Jewish People<\/h1>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Romans 11 also prevents Christians from claiming that God simply hates or has permanently abandoned the Jewish people.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ul writes concerning Israel: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cAs regards election, they are beloved for the sake of their forefathers.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">And then: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<blockquote class=\"w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ow\">\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>\u201cFor the gifts and the calling of God are irrevocable.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u2014 Romans 11:28-29<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ul even looks toward a mysterious future work of God concerning Israel.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Therefore Christianity must reject two opposite errors.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The first error is to claim that ethnic ancestry alone guarantees salvation apart from Christ.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The second error is to despise the Jewish people as though God&#8217;s work through Israel means nothing.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Paul rejects both.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h1 class=\"wp-block-heading\">One
